Discover the Charm of Mill Ridge Farm

Mill Ridge Farm is a stunning destination that showcases the elegance and beauty of thoroughbred horse breeding. Located in Lexington, Kentucky, this farm is set against a backdrop of rolling hills and lush pastures, creating a serene atmosphere perfect for a day out. Visitors can explore the farm's sprawling grounds, where they will find well-cared-for horses and knowledgeable staff eager to share insights into the breeding process and the care of these magnificent animals. The farm is renowned for its contributions to the racing industry, and tours often include opportunities to meet some of the champion horses that call Mill Ridge home. In addition to its equestrian offerings, Mill Ridge Farm serves as a tourist attraction that highlights the rich agricultural heritage of Kentucky. The knowledgeable guides provide fascinating stories about the farm's history, the horses, and the breeding techniques that make it a leader in the industry.
